☐ Step 4 — Kiosk watchdog attestation key. Reviewer: verify that the Oakstand kiosk watchdog's attestation key was generated inside the Ferrow enclave and never exported in plaintext. Confirm the watchdog's restart counter was zeroed post-generation and that both ceremony witnesses signed the Larkmoor ledger. Any deviation voids the ceremony and requires a full restart. Once verification is complete, seal the envelope containing the recovery passphrase recorded below.

vault phrase of bafop-kahop = sormir-frador

For the incoming director. Q3 revenue in the Westmoor territory landed 7% below plan. Shortfall driven by delayed Trellix renewals and underperformance in the Carden sub-region. Pipeline coverage now 2.1x, up from 1.6x. Headcount: two open rep roles, one frozen. Marten Oduya has stabilized the top five accounts; churn risk remains on Bellwick Foods. Recommended actions: reassign Carden accounts, accelerate renewal incentives, review comp plan. Decisions needed within two weeks. The confidential note on business plans appears below.

internal memo for hahaf-kahof: Only 39 of the 428 pilot accounts renewed Sorion, so a churn review is set for April 12. Praokix Freight is in early talks to buy Queniusox Group for about $145.8 million.

# Tax-rate lookup cache for the Dapperfield checkout service.
# Rates change rarely (quarterly at most), so we cache aggressively,
# but regulators occasionally issue mid-quarter corrections — hence
# the forced refresh interval. Don't crank the TTL up just because
# the upstream rate service is slow; that bit us once already.
# If you change anything here, ping the payments channel first.
# The current values are as follows.

tuning table, kajog-kawef:
PRIORITIES = {
    "kelox": 870,
    "kasix": 89,
    "eliax": 988,
}